1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are metals?

Back

Metals are materials that are typically hard, shiny, and good conductors of heat and electricity. Examples include copper, iron, and aluminum.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What happens to liquid wax when it cools down?

Back

When liquid wax cools down, it solidifies and turns back into solid wax.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What materials are the best conductors of electricity?

Back

Metals are the best conductors of electricity, allowing electric current to flow easily.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is likely to be inside a container that looks empty?

Back

A container that looks empty is likely to contain gas, which is not visible.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What materials are the worst insulators?

Back

Metals are the worst insulators because they allow heat to pass through easily.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an insulator?

Back

An insulator is a material that does not conduct heat or electricity well, such as wood or plastic.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a conductor?

Back

A conductor is a material that allows heat or electricity to pass through easily, such as metals.
